He has a big future shaping the future' <i>Observer</i></b><br><b><i><br></i></b><b>'A more politically radical Malcolm Gladwell' <i>New York Times</i></b><b><i><br><br></i></b><b>'The Dutch wunderkind of new ideas' <i>Guardian</i></b><br><b><br></b>In <i>Utopia for Realists</i>, Rutger Bregman shows that we can construct a society with visionary ideas that are, in fact, wholly implementable. Every milestone of civilisation – from the end of slavery to the beginning of democracy – was once considered a utopian fantasy. New utopian ideas such as universal basic income and a fifteen-hour work week can become reality in our lifetime.<br><br>From a Canadian city that once completely eradicated poverty, to Richard Nixon's near implementation of a basic income for millions of Americans, Bregman takes us on a journey through history, beyond the traditional left-right divides, as he introduces ideas whose time has come.<br><b></b>
